The CTR can be improved by better ad placement and suitable blending of the ads with the contents Better ad placement means placing the ads at vantage points preferably at the top left or right side of your content and medium or large rectangle ad formats do better than the other formats. Blending of ad means hiding of your ads with the contents so that they will not reveal explicitly. - Dairyman

your ad placement is good, did a good job on blending in the ads. reason your CTR is low on the entertainment site is because its about prety much everything. hardly any content and all links. therefore you are not getting any targeted ads. your ads are also just abot anything starting from rigntone download to youtube ads. you need to target a specific niche to get targeted ads and get good CTR. right now, google doesn;t know what is yor site about therefore all kinds of ads are being diaplayed
